Job Description

The Davis College of Agriculture and Natural Resources at West Virginia University (WVU) invites applications for a part-time adjunct faculty to support the Davis College's Environmental, Energy, and Land Management Program in the 2026 fall semester. Available courses include ENLM 200 (Principles of Land Management; Tuesdays & Thursdays 12:30-1:45pm) and ENLM 220 (Energy Production and Operations; Tuesdays & Thursdays 3:30-4:45pm).

The College's mission is rooted in the land-grant tradition-preparing students for impactful careers, advancing knowledge through research and innovation, and serving the people of West Virginia and beyond. The Environmental, Energy and Land Management program trains students in the areas of land management, energy, business, law, policy, GIS, and environmental science.

  • A graduate degree relevant to the course(s) taught is required at the time of appointment; a doctoral degree is preferred. Significant work experience and professional certifications may be substituted for a graduate degree.
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ate effectively and teach undergraduate and/or graduate students.
  • Experience with student-centered instruction, inclusive pedagogy, and/or experiential learning approaches is desirable.
  • Professional experience in applied settings relevant to the course(s) taught is preferred.

Application Process

To apply, visit https://careers.wvu.edu/career-opportunities. Applicants should submit:

  • A cover letter indicating discipline(s) and course(s) of interest, availability, and relevant teaching or professional experience
  • A current curriculum vitae
  • A brief statement of teaching philosophy
  • Contact information for at least three professional references

About the Davis College

Established in 1867, the Davis College is the oldest academic unit at WVU and reflects the land-grant mission through interdisciplinary programs in agriculture, design, natural resources, and the life sciences. The College fosters a learning environment where students engage in hands-on experiences, research, and community partnerships that build meaningful, purpose-driven careers.
